Issue/Introduction
XVmotion(Storage and compute) fails with the following error
“Failed to load some of the disks of the virtual machine.”
Validated the vmkernel.log on the ESXI
Failed waiting for data. Error 195887167. Connection closed by remote host, possibly due to timeout. ###-##-##T18:58:51.725716Z Failed to create one or more destination disks. A fatal internal error occurred. See the virtual machine's log for more details. vMotion migration [18#####8675:8474#####41106] failed to read stream keepalive: Connection closed by remote host, possibly due to timeout
The disks are stored on the local Storage of the ESXI
Environment
VMware vCenter Server 7.x
VMware vCenter Server 8.x
Cause
This error typically indicates a transient issue where the destination host was temporarily unable to access one or more of the VM’s disk files. Potential causes include temporary file locking, host agent cache inconsistencies, or brief storage/network access delays.
